Gather Necessary Records
Gathering essential records is necessary for your DWI court hearing. Beginning by collecting all appropriate paperwork related to your instance. This includes your apprehension report, citation, and any breath or blood test outcomes. These documents provide essential information that can impact your defense and will assist you comprehend the specifics of the charges against you.
Next, collect any proof that supports your instance. This might include witness declarations, photographs, or any other documents that can help develop your side of the story. If you've finished any type of alcohol education and learning programs, include those certifications also; they can reveal the court your commitment to resolving the problem.
Do not fail to remember to get your driving record. A tidy driving history can work in your support and demonstrate that this occurrence was out of character for you.
Finally, keep copies of all records organized and easily accessible. This not just aids you remain ready yet additionally enables your attorney to examine every little thing completely.
Being well-prepared with the appropriate records can make a considerable distinction in how your hearing profits, so take this step seriously.
Speak With Legal Professionals
Consulting with attorneys is a vital step in preparing for your DWI court hearing. A seasoned attorney can supply you with important understandings right into the legal process, assisting you comprehend the charges against you and possible defenses.
They'll assess your instance's specifics, consisting of the scenarios of your apprehension and any evidence accumulated, to create a solid method. You need to choose an attorney who specializes in drunk driving instances, as they'll recognize with neighborhood legislations and court procedures.
During your appointment, do not think twice to ask questions. Clarify the prospective effects you may face, such as fines, certificate suspension, or prison time. Talk about whether you could be eligible for appeal deals or alternative sentencing choices.
In addition, your lawyer can assist you on what to anticipate throughout the hearing, decreasing your anxiety and aiding you feel extra ready. They can additionally represent you in court, guaranteeing your civil liberties are safeguarded throughout the process.
